You may also want to consider assigning a number to each guest and lightly marking that number on the rsvp card in the event a card is returned with an illegible name or no name at all! The wording you choose depends on what sort of response you require from your guest: how many people will attend, the meal choice they prefer, or you may also want to find out who will attend another wedding event that same weekend, e.g. These days, however, it is common to include a response card (along with a stamped and addressed envelope). Traditionally, no rsvp card was included (or a blank card was used) with an invitation- guests knew they were expected to respond to the host as to whether they would attend the event.
